RaoMeng 6 rokov pred
rodič
commit
e57d4f4117

+ 5 - 2
WeiChat/src/main/java/com/xzjmyk/pm/activity/ui/erp/activity/WebViewCommActivity.java

@@ -94,7 +94,7 @@ public class WebViewCommActivity extends BaseActivity implements View.OnClickLis
     private String mSubsAct;
     private int mPosition;
 
-    private String mSubsurl;
+    private String mSubsurl, mWhichPage;
     private TextView mPreTv;
     private TextView mNextTv;
     private List<Object> mReadSubs;
@@ -156,6 +156,7 @@ public class WebViewCommActivity extends BaseActivity implements View.OnClickLis
         pb.setMax(100);
         url = intent.getStringExtra("url");
         mSubsurl = intent.getStringExtra("url");
+        mWhichPage = intent.getStringExtra("whichPage");
         isCookie = intent.getBooleanExtra("cookie", false);
         String msg_title = intent.getStringExtra("title");
         if (!StringUtil.isEmpty(msg_title)) {
@@ -555,7 +556,9 @@ public class WebViewCommActivity extends BaseActivity implements View.OnClickLis
 
     @Override
     public boolean onCreateOptionsMenu(Menu menu) {
-        getMenuInflater().inflate(R.menu.menu_about, menu);
+        if (!"real_time".equals(mWhichPage)) {
+            getMenuInflater().inflate(R.menu.menu_about, menu);
+        }
         return true;
     }
 

+ 1 - 1
app_core/common/src/main/java/com/core/utils/CommonUtil.java

@@ -109,7 +109,7 @@ public class CommonUtil {
 //        if (BaseConfig.isDebug()){
 //            baseUrl="http://117.25.180.218:8090/zz_test/";
 //        }
-//        baseUrl = "http://117.25.180.218:8090/zz_test/";
+        baseUrl = "http://117.25.180.218:8090/zz_test/";
 //        baseUrl = "http://10.1.80.180:8080/uas_war_exploded/";
 //        baseUrl = "http://10.1.80.111:8080/uas/";
         return baseUrl;

+ 0 - 3
app_modular/apputils/src/main/java/com/modular/apputils/activity/BillInputActivity.java

@@ -272,9 +272,6 @@ public class BillInputActivity extends OABaseActivity implements IBill, BillAdap
                                 mBillAdapter.switchTabData(tabPosition);
                                 mBillAdapter.notifyDataSetChanged();
                                 mRecyclerView.scrollToPosition(mBillAdapter.mTabIndex);
-//                                WrapContentLinearLayoutManager mLayoutManager =
-//                                        (WrapContentLinearLayoutManager) mRecyclerView.getLayoutManager();
-//                                mLayoutManager.scrollToPositionWithOffset(mBillAdapter.mTabIndex, 0);
                             }
                         }
 

+ 1 - 1
app_modular/appworks/src/main/java/com/uas/appworks/CRM/erp/activity/DeviceBillInputActivity.java

@@ -116,7 +116,7 @@ public class DeviceBillInputActivity extends BillInputActivity {
     }
 
     private void selectDf(int position, BillGroupModel.BillModel model, Bundle extras, String condition) {
-        if ("DF".equals(model.getType())) {
+        if ("DF".equals(model.getType()) || "SF".equals(model.getType())) {
             findBydbFind(model, condition, extras);
         } else {
             super.toSelect(position, model);

+ 2 - 0
app_modular/appworks/src/main/java/com/uas/appworks/CRM/erp/activity/DeviceDataFormAddActivity.java

@@ -1808,6 +1808,7 @@ public class DeviceDataFormAddActivity extends SupportToolBarActivity implements
         params.put("caller", caller);
         params.put("formStore", formStore);
         params.put("gridStore", gridStore);
+        params.put("id", formid);
         LinkedHashMap<String, Object> headers = new LinkedHashMap<>();
         headers.put("Cookie", "JSESSIONID=" + CommonUtil.getSharedPreferences(ct, "sessionId"));
         ViewUtil.httpSendRequest(ct, url, params, mHandler, headers, Constants.HTTP_SUCCESS_INIT, null, null, "post");
@@ -2013,6 +2014,7 @@ public class DeviceDataFormAddActivity extends SupportToolBarActivity implements
         String url = CommonUtil.getAppBaseUrl(ct) + "mobile/device/updateAndSubmitDeviceChange.action";
         Map<String, Object> params = new HashMap<>();
         params.put("caller", caller);
+        params.put("id", formid);
         params.put("formStore", formStore);
         if (!"[]".equals(gridStore)) {
             params.put("gridStore", gridStore);

+ 1 - 0
app_modular/appworks/src/main/java/com/uas/appworks/activity/RealTimeFormActivity.java

@@ -67,6 +67,7 @@ public class RealTimeFormActivity extends BaseActivity {
                 Intent intent = new Intent("com.modular.main.WebViewCommActivity");
                 intent.putExtra("url", url);
                 intent.putExtra("title", title);
+                intent.putExtra("whichPage", "real_time");
                 intent.putExtra("ORIENTATION_PORTRAIT", false);
                 intent.putExtra("cookie", true);
                 startActivity(intent);

+ 12 - 1
app_modular/appworks/src/main/java/com/uas/appworks/adapter/DeviceBillInputAdapter.java

@@ -19,7 +19,18 @@ public class DeviceBillInputAdapter extends BillAdapter {
         if ("dd_source".equals(model.getField())) {
             //针对dd_source特殊处理,如果有值,则展示【是】,没值则展示否
             String value = model.getValue();
-            if (TextUtils.isEmpty(value)) {
+            int source = 0;
+            try {
+                source = Integer.parseInt(value);
+            } catch (Exception e) {
+                if (!TextUtils.isEmpty(value) && !"0".equals(value)) {
+                    source = 1;
+                } else {
+                    source = 0;
+                }
+                e.printStackTrace();
+            }
+            if (source <= 0) {
                 mInputViewHolder.valuesEd.setText("否");
             } else {
                 mInputViewHolder.valuesEd.setText("是");